Shipping Temperature Healthcare Products in Passive Reusable Thermal Shippers

In this presentation from the 1st Cold Chain & Temperature Control Distribution Online Summit in May 2011, Boriana Cavicchia Senior Associate at PwC, discusses:
- How to evaluate if this approach is suitable for your need
- Existing international regulations and best practices
- Closed vs. open loop scenarios
- Considerations for packaging materials
- Process steps and quality control

Presenters:
Boriana Cavicchia
Manager of Systems Quality & Biomedical Services
Department of Veterans Affairs
Boriana Cavicchia is currently a program analyst at the Veterans Health Administration. She has more than 20 years of experience in pharmaceutical, vaccine, and blood banking industries, quality assurance, and research. Boriana is a co-author in numerous Parenteral Drug Association (PDA) publications dedicated to Cold Chain logistics. Throughout her career with government, nonprofit , pharmaceutical and biotech industries, she has specialized in Risk management assessments applied to the Temperature-Controlled Distribution Chain.
